SECTION 4, CONTROLS & INSTRUMENTATION
GENERAL DESCRIPTION
GENERAL DESCRIPTION
- The Gardner Denver rotary screw compressor package is pre-wired with all
electrical components suitable for the voltage and horsepower at time of order. It is only necessary to
connect the compressor unit to the correct power supply, to the shop air supply network. A standard
single stage compressor package consists of an unitized module that houses a single rotary screw
compressor, oil sump, separation, filtering, and internal injection delivery system, a main drive motor, a
VFD, an oil/air cooling system, Nema 4 electrical enclosure to house VFD on common controller and a
sound-attenuating enclosure. The various control devices employed are described as follows:
Controller
- The compressor package features the AirSmart controller, which integrates all the control
functions under microprocessor control. Controller functions include safety and shutdown, compressor
regulation, operator control and advisory/maintenance indicators. The keypad and display provides a
logical and easily operated control of the compressor and indication of its condition. The controller is
factory adjusted for the compressor package, but allows tuning for specific applications.

Press the red “STOP/RESET” button to clear any conditions (e.g., “Loss of Power” when electrical system
was energized) and start the unit by pushing the green “START” button. Since the unit is equipped with a
minimum pressure (60 psig, 4.1 bar) valve, no special procedure to maintain minimum reservoir pressure
is required.
Main VFD and Motor
– The compressor is driven by an inverter-duty electric motor, which in turn is
energized by a pulse-width modulated, variable frequency drive (commonly referred to as VFD). This
combination of components enables the compressor package to match the supply of compressed air
(e.g., flow capacity) to meet the customer’s demand in real time and in a step-less fashion. The
operational logic which governs the drive and motor-combination is supplied by the AirSmart controller
and it is based on the following basic rules:
•
The speed of the compressor is modulated (e.g., increased or decreased) until the desired system
discharge pressure is achieved.
The drive shares a common Nema 4 protected enclosure with the AirSmart controller and assorted
electrical hardware. Ventilation for the electronics is supplied forced air delivered by the heat exchanger
cooling fan. The heat sink extends out the back of the control box. The drive is installed with gasketing to
keep the Nema 4 rating on the control box. The motor is built with a TEFC protected frame and mounted
directly to the package base – the compressor is pivoted on one axis to provide adjustability for the power
transmitting V-belts. The drive includes adequate current overload protection for its companion motor.
